Raman and infrared studies of [N(CH3)4]2ZnCl4

A normal versus superspace description

Abstract

The relevance of a superspace description for Raman and infrared spectra in the commensurate phases of [N(CH3)4]2ZnCl4 has been studied. The selection rules for light scattering have been determined in all phases using as well the normal space groups as one superspace group for all phases. The results have been compared with experimental data. Special attention has been devoted to the domain structure in the two monoclinic phases.
